| Birth: | Nov. 1, 1830 | | Death: | Jan. 15, 1915 |  Civil War Union Brevet Brigadier General, US Congressman. Served during the Civil War as Colonel and commander of the 122nd Illinois Volunteer Infantry. He was brevetted Brigadier General, US Volunteers on March 13, 1865 for "gallant and meritorious services". He became a prominent Illinois lawyer after the war, and was elected to represent Illinois 16th District in the United States House of Representatives, serving from 1895 to 1897.
